Zamalek manager Mohamed Helmi voiced confidence regarding his side's chance when they face Sundowns away in the Champions league group stage phase on Wednesday.

The South African side stunned Zamalek 2-1 at home, two weeks earlier, to top the group B with six points, three ahead of the Cairo Giants who are looking to regain the group summit with a win in Pretoria.

"The clash will be very tough given the importance of the game for the two sides," Helmi told reporters on Monday.

"We will be looking for a win in Pretoria and I am sure that my team are capable to earn a win away."

The Zamalek boss admitted that his side will be affected by the absence of several key players but he says he is confident that the substitute players will be capable to fill the void left by the absentees.

Team starters Mohamed Koffi, Mohamed Ibrahim and Tarek Hamed will all miss Wedenesday's clash for different reasons.

"The absence of this trio is a great loss but we have good substitutes.'' he concluded.
